Barbara Adams, head of the Windbrook Library in suburban Chicago, has died, apparently from a fall down the stairs to the library's basement. But when Julia Fairbanks, her closest friend's daughter starts to poke around, she finds troubling emails that indicate Barbara was not the victim of a heart attack, but a vicious killer instead. Can Julia find the murderer? Or will she end up on The Last Page?

This cozy mystery is a novella, approx. 20,000 words was a collaborative effort with David J. Walker. It also includes two short stories by us, both from the acclaimed crime fiction anthology, CHICAGO BLUES.
